Boston's The Autumn Hollow Band is headlining a show this Saturday night at Bad Abbots (1546 Handcock St., Quincy) to benefit the St. Boniface Haiti Foundation, a US-based charitable organization helping the people of a desperately poor rural region of Fond des Blancs, Haiti. Also on the bill are NYC band The Loom and local Joanna Newsom-esque outfit Mr. Sister.Listen to The Autumn Hollow Band below and if you like what you hear, you can download their recent EP for free on the band's website. A full-length is due this summer.
